Recently picked up a Peavey Ultra Plus 120 in very bad shape (rust, broken pots,..). I'm trying to restore it as much as possible.
One issue I'm facing is it's missing some knobs. I found that the partnumber is: peavey 70902179. I'm afraid they don't make them anymore, but I was hoping someone would have an idea of where to find them used.
Next I will be replacing some pots, if anyone has some info on the electronics, pls share.

P.S. Re: pots and other parts:
If Peavey Parts can't help you refer to the schematic and parts list to find components with the same values and physical size. I got a non-standard replacement volume pot for another maker's effects/preamp by doing just this.
